DG ISPR Lieutenant General Ahmed Sharif Chaudhry (DG ISPR) assailed incarcerated former premier Imran Khan, calling him a “threat to national security” and warning that no one will be allowed to incite the public against the armed forces.
He said that Khan’s “anti-army” rhetoric has crossed the limits of politics and now poses a direct threat to the nation’s security.

Addressing a press conference in Rawalpindi, the DG ISPR described a “creeping national security threat” that the military has deemed necessary to confront.
